From Burnout to Breakthrough:

—Rediscovering the Joy of Leadership

Most entrepreneurs don’t start a business because they want to work harder or put in more hours.

That’s crazy, right?!

They start because they love their trade or craft. But when you’re the one in charge—the one who has to make sure the work gets done—you often start to shoulder burdens that eventually become unmanageable.

The joy you once had eventually dries up, leaving you with more work, more stress, and a desperate search for an escape.

In a recent episode of the No More Carbon Copies podcast, Andy Gittus, a general contractor from Franklin, Tennessee, shared how this all-too-common experience nearly caused him to throw in the towel and sell his business.

Survival vs. Flourishing

We often fall into the trap of believing that leadership is synonymous with "surviving the week". We treat work as a series of heavy tasks we have to endure.

But work doesn’t need to be a purely transactional effort. Your work has the potential to become a place where you feel fully “alive”—where you’re providing value that not only sustains your family but actually breathes life into the organizations and people you serve.

When you’re working in survival mode, you aren't leading; you’re reacting. Moving from surviving to thriving requires more than just a shorter work week; it requires a fundamental shift in the way you view your role and your identity.

Understanding Your "Sweet Spot"

Real work-life balance doesn't start with an optimized calendar; it starts with understanding who you are as a leader. High-impact leadership happens when you stop trying to be everything to everyone and instead focus on your "Sweet Spot".

Your sweet spot is the intersection of your unique competency, the value you bring, and the activities and environments that bring you the most joy.

Finding the Strategic Alignment of Your Sweet Spot

Your sweet spot isn’t just a "feel-good" concept; it is the heart of your professional impact.

When you operate outside of it, you aren't just tired—you are inefficient. You end up spreading yourself thin across tasks that others could do better, which actually costs your business more in the long run.

To move from survival to flourishing, you must align your leadership with three critical pillars:

  • Leadership Identity: Real confidence starts with an accurate understanding of who you are, rather than listening to the "negative voices" that skew your self-perception.

    When you stop guessing about your value and lean into your verified strengths, you can lead with humble confidence rather than insecurity.

    For Andy, this meant moving past the belief that he was a poor decision-maker and accepting that he actually possessed exceptional judgment.

  • Motivation: True thriving requires you to identify the specific activities and environments that bring you joy and energy.

    When you align your daily schedule with what motivates you—such as in-person interactions with clients—you can work harder and longer without reaching the point of burnout because the work sustains you.

  • Impact: Being great at something you love is wonderful, but by definition, that’s a hobby.

    Professional impact occurs when you identify the intersection between your true motivations, your leadership identity, and the value you create for your business and the people around you.

The Decision to "Fire Yourself"

Aligning with your sweet spot often requires the courage to "fire yourself" from the roles that drain you.

For Andy, this meant delegating the very important administrative "heavy lifting" to those better suited for it, allowing him to focus on the high-value areas of the business where his unique abilities had the highest return on investment.

The result isn't just a better business; it’s a richer life. You stop working to live and start leading with a foundation of clarity that transforms your business and your community.
